Triplophysa angeli is a species of stone loach in the genus Triplophysa. It is endemic to the Yalong River in Sichuan, China. It grows to SL.
The specific name honours the herpetologist Fernand Angel (1881âÂÂ1950) of the Muséum national d'Histoire naturelle in Paris, "who was "always interested" (translation) in Fang's work".
